Tinubu and Alia

June 17, (THEWILL) – Governor Hyacinth Alia has expressed optimism that President Tinubu’s proposed visit to Benue State on Wednesday will reinforce the Federal Government’s commitment to not only restoring lasting peace but also ensuring security in all troubled parts of the state.

He describes the visit, coming after the horrific terrorist attack on Yelewata in Guma Local Government Area, where very many innocent lives were lost to a brutal onslaught by armed herdsmen, as a profound gesture of solidarity and compassion.

In a statement signed by the Chief Press Secretary, Sir Tersoo Kula in Makurdi on Tuesday, noted that such a visit depicts the President’s concern and readiness to take a bold step in the face of worsening insecurity threatening the peace, dignity, and existence of our farming communities.

According to Governor Alia, the Government and people of Benue state are fully prepared to receive President Tinubu, noting that the visit represents not only a moment of national empathy, but a rare opportunity to directly interface with the Presidency on urgent security interventions needed to end the persistent killings and displacement of Benue people.

“If there is any state in the country that needs absolute peace, that state is Benue. This is because, as the ‘Food Basket of the Nation,’ Benue deserves peace, protection, and justice”, the statement added.

“As we invite all stakeholders to get ready to welcome and interface with Mr President, we equally urge our people to remain calm, law-abiding, and prayerful as we receive the number one citizen of our great country”, the governor appealed.

Meanwhile, some survivors of the Yelwata attacks by terrorists herdsmen have been evacuated and camped at the Ultra Modern International Market Makurdi, where they are enjoying good shelter, water, security and other facilities at the moment.
